Weatherby rifle winner helps with good cause
by Tom Bonnette - posted E-mail Story E-mail Story | Print Story Print Story 
When Charles Dean of Swartz, kills a deer with his new Weatherby 270 bolt-action rifle, he will have the satisfaction of knowing that he helped out with a good cause.

Dean recently won the weapon in a raffle to help John Arnold of Delhi, pay hospital bills. Arnold was hospitalized when his tractor collided with a semi-truck.

Gilmer Lee, a friend of Arnold, helped organize the raffle in which $7,580 dollars were raised.
